Eighty per cent of success is showing up, as they say. So, all but one of Hong Kong’s 89 legislators joining a week-long “national affairs study visit” to Beijing made a good impression.
Lawmaker Stanley Ng Chau-pei called it a “groundbreaking opportunity” for legislators to study and deepen their understanding of national conditions. Showing up eager to learn and to better grasp how Hong Kong can play a more proactive role in national development is indeed commendable.
